**Ingredients Matter**

Natural blood sugar supplements often contain various ingredients known for their potential benefits in glucose regulation. Familiarize yourself with common components such as:

– **Glucomannan:** A natural fiber that may help reduce carbohydrate absorption.
– **Cinnamon:** Research suggests it could improve insulin sensitivity and reduce blood sugar levels.
– **Berberine:** This compound has shown promise in lowering blood glucose and improving metabolic health.
– **Chromium:** An essential trace mineral that plays a role in carbohydrate and fat metabolism.

When comparing supplements, read the labels carefully to ensure they contain effective and evidence-backed ingredients. Avoid products with synthetic additives or unnecessary fillers.

**Consultation and Monitoring**

Before beginning any supplement, especially if you are already on medications for blood sugar management, consulting a healthcare professional is crucial. Supplements can interact with medications, and a professional can guide you through any potential risks.

Furthermore, once you’ve selected a supplement, monitor your blood sugar levels regularly to gauge its effectiveness. Keep a log of how you feel, any changes in energy levels, and your overall well-being. This ongoing assessment will help you determine if the supplement meets your needs or if you might benefit from trying a different one.
